Manchester City have been encouraged in the battle for Borussia Dortmund midfielder Jude Bellingham.

The Sun says Bellingham could leave Dortmund for £83million next summer – if the entire fee is paid up front.

And Manchester City are convinced they will win what is sure to be a battle of the big guns to bring him to England.

Liverpool have a long-established interest in the Three Lions midfielder, and believed they were favourites.

Chelsea are also big fans, while Manchester United would love him at Old Trafford, but know they need a top four finish to have any hope.

There are suggestions Dortmund want over £130m for the teenager, yet sources claim the true price could be nearly £50m less — as long as it is paid in one go.

City are certainly best-placed to do that, as well as offering the best chance of silverware – and the opportunity to link up with his old Dortmund team-mate Erling Haaland.
